Removing an MX480 SCB-MX
1. Take the host subsystem offline.
2. Place an electrostatic bag or antistatic mat on a flat, stable surface.
3. Attach an ESD grounding strap to your bare wrist and connect the strap to one of the ESD points on
the chassis.
4. Rotate the ejector handles simultaneously counterclockwise to unseat the Switch Control Board.
5. Grasp the ejector handles, and slide the Switch Control Board about halfway out of the chassis.
6. Place one hand underneath the Switch Control Board to support it, and slide it completely out of the
chassis.
